Customer Experience IS the Foundation for Blue Collar Trades with Brad Huebner

Customers First Podcast

On this episode of the Customers First Podcast, I have an inspiring conversation with Brad Huebner, a former Marine and dedicated business coach specializing in guiding contractors. Based on his military experience, Brad underscores the vital leadership, determination, and perseverance qualities that shape his coaching approach. With a remarkable track record of over 2,500 construction projects, he is committed to helping tradespeople navigate the complexities of building resilient and principled businesses. 

Brad's unique journey—from aspiring architect to Marine to successful business owner—has equipped him with invaluable insights. After confronting the challenges of entrepreneurship, he embraced coaching as his true calling, igniting a passion for helping others succeed without sacrificing their values. 

Throughout our engaging discussion, we address a pressing issue in the construction industry: the balance between quality and quantity in work output. Brad openly acknowledges today's challenges while affirming that most contractors strive to deliver exceptional experiences.

 We delve into the critical importance of the customer experience, with Brad passionately advocating for a mindset shift among contractors. By embracing their roles as consultants rather than salespeople, contractors can cultivate genuine connections with clients, greatly enhancing overall satisfaction. 

As we wrap up, Brad emphasizes effective communication as a cornerstone of success in all interactions, reminding us that fostering customer-centric cultures unlocks the potential for transformative experiences. Whether you're a seasoned pro or a newcomer to the industry, Brad's insights guide you, helping you overcome challenges while remaining true to your core values.
